Transaction ed5a36cc7c8fffe818616ac15129555372a51f1614a4c76561743389c7bd0e61
1 Input
1 Output
-
ed5a36cc7c8fffe818616ac15129555372a51f1614a4c76561743389c7bd0e61:0
- value
- 13798854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cb7266f3a3082231d7621055e10e9b0136b3970 OP_EQUAL
- address
- 3QjFcNxo17WJzPtS8Wr9KMTSQeQw1a5tTg